1. 什么是移動(dòng)文件夾
移動(dòng)文件夾是指將一個(gè)文件夾從一個(gè)位置移動(dòng)到另一個(gè)位置的操作。在Linux系統(tǒng)中,使用命令行可以輕松地進(jìn)行文件夾的移動(dòng)操作。移動(dòng)文件夾可以幫助我們重新組織文件結(jié)構(gòu),使文件管理更加高效。
2. 使用mv命令移動(dòng)文件夾
在Linux系統(tǒng)中,使用mv命令可以移動(dòng)文件夾。該命令的基本語法如下:
mv [選項(xiàng)] 源文件夾 目標(biāo)文件夾
其中,選項(xiàng)是可選的,可以用于控制移動(dòng)過程中的一些行為。源文件夾是要移動(dòng)的文件夾的路徑,目標(biāo)文件夾是文件夾要移動(dòng)到的路徑。
3. 移動(dòng)文件夾的基本用法
要移動(dòng)一個(gè)文件夾,首先需要知道源文件夾的路徑和目標(biāo)文件夾的路徑??梢允褂媒^對(duì)路徑或相對(duì)路徑來指定文件夾的位置。絕對(duì)路徑是從根目錄開始的完整路徑,而相對(duì)路徑是相對(duì)于當(dāng)前工作目錄的路徑。
例如,要將一個(gè)名為"folder1"的文件夾移動(dòng)到當(dāng)前工作目錄下的"folder2"文件夾中,可以使用以下命令:
mv folder1 folder2
4. 移動(dòng)文件夾時(shí)的注意事項(xiàng)
在移動(dòng)文件夾時(shí),需要注意一些事項(xiàng)。目標(biāo)文件夾必須存在,否則移動(dòng)操作將失敗。如果目標(biāo)文件夾中已經(jīng)存在同名的文件夾,移動(dòng)操作將覆蓋目標(biāo)文件夾。
如果要移動(dòng)的文件夾包含大量文件或子文件夾,移動(dòng)操作可能需要一些時(shí)間。在移動(dòng)過程中,可以使用-v選項(xiàng)來顯示詳細(xì)的移動(dòng)信息,以便及時(shí)了解移動(dòng)進(jìn)度。
5. 移動(dòng)文件夾的高級(jí)用法
除了基本的移動(dòng)操作外,mv命令還提供了一些高級(jí)用法。例如,可以使用-r選項(xiàng)來遞歸地移動(dòng)文件夾及其所有子文件夾和文件。這對(duì)于移動(dòng)包含多層次文件結(jié)構(gòu)的文件夾非常有用。
可以使用-i選項(xiàng)來在移動(dòng)過程中進(jìn)行交互,以便在目標(biāo)文件夾中存在同名文件夾時(shí)進(jìn)行確認(rèn)操作。這可以避免意外覆蓋文件夾。
6. 示例:移動(dòng)文件夾的實(shí)際應(yīng)用
為了更好地理解移動(dòng)文件夾的實(shí)際應(yīng)用,我們來看一個(gè)示例。假設(shè)我們有一個(gè)名為"documents"的文件夾,其中包含了多個(gè)子文件夾和文件。現(xiàn)在,我們想將該文件夾移動(dòng)到我們的用戶目錄下。
我們需要打開終端并進(jìn)入"documents"文件夾所在的目錄。然后,使用以下命令將文件夾移動(dòng)到用戶目錄下:
mv documents ~
這將把"documents"文件夾移動(dòng)到當(dāng)前用戶的主目錄下。
7. 小結(jié)
移動(dòng)文件夾是Linux系統(tǒng)中常用的操作之一。通過mv命令,我們可以輕松地將文件夾從一個(gè)位置移動(dòng)到另一個(gè)位置。在移動(dòng)文件夾時(shí),需要注意目標(biāo)文件夾的存在和同名文件夾的處理。mv命令還提供了一些高級(jí)用法,如遞歸移動(dòng)和交互式移動(dòng)。通過掌握這些技巧,我們可以更好地管理和組織我們的文件結(jié)構(gòu)。